Secretary Jobs in Anniston, AL

A Secretary in the admin industry plays a pivotal role in ensuring smooth operations within an organization. They are responsible for handling office tasks such as answering phone calls, organizing files, scheduling appointments, and managing correspondence. They also maintain office supplies, prepare reports, and draft documents. Secretaries often act as the first point of contact for clients and visitors, so they must have excellent communication and interpersonal skills. They should also have proficiency in office management software like Microsoft Office Suite and have excellent organizational skills.

Before becoming a Secretary, a person might have held roles such as an Administrative Assistant, Receptionist, or Office Clerk. These positions help develop the necessary skills and experience for succeeding as a Secretary. Additionally, while not always required, having certifications like the Certified Administrative Professional (CAP) or the Microsoft Office Specialist (MOS) can enhance a Secretary's job prospects and prove their competence in crucial administrative tasks.

Highest Education Level

Secretarys in Anniston, AL off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
31.9%
High School or GED
25.4%
Associate's Degree
17.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
13.3%
Master's Degree
8.0%
Some College
2.2%
Doctorate Degree
0.9%
Some High School
0.8%
